    Description / Table of Contents: Tetrahydrofuran Acids - A New Class of Compounds in Human MetabolismA previously unknown acid, tetrahydro-2,5-furandiacetic acid (3,6-epoxyoctanedioic acid) (1a) is excreted in human urine in daily rates in a 3 to 5-mg range. The homologues 2a, 3a, 4a, and 5a were also found, but they occur only in trace amounts.

    Description / Table of Contents: Antibiotics from Basidiomycetes, XX. - Synthesis of Strobilurin A and Revision of the Stereochemistry of Natural StrobilurinsCondensation of cinnamaldehyde (5) with 2-oxobutyric acid (6) leads to the (E,E)-keto acid 7 which is converted into (9E)-strobilurin (1a) via methyl ester 9 and Wittig reaction of the latter with (methoxymethylene)triphenylphosphorane. On irradiation 1a undergoes inversion at the double bond in position 9 and yields strobilurin A (1b) which is identical with the natural product. Due to this result the (9Z) stereochemistry has to be assigned to all natural strobilurins 1b-4b, contrary to former formulations. This assignment is further supported by spectral comparison of 1a and 1b as well as by thermal cyclization of 1b to the biphenyl derivative 11. The latter can also be obtained by condensation of methyl 2-(methoxymethylene)acetoacetate (13) with cinnamylidenetriphenylphosphorane (12). Base-catalyzed condensation of 13 yields dimethyl 4-hydroxyisophthalate (14).

    Description / Table of Contents: The Structure of Stenothricin - Revision of a Previous Structure AssignmentA deviation from the previously assumed molecular mass was proved by fast-atom bombardment mass-spectrometry for the peptide antibiotic stenothricin. Recent investigations of a partial hydrolyzate revealed the presence of α-ketobutyrylvaline formed by hydrolysis of an α,β-dehydroaminobutyric acid (DH-Abu) moiety. Fragments obtained by partial hydrolysis of stenothricin after catalytic hydrogenation show that the previously identified tripeptide D-aThr-L-Ser-L-Dpr is linked over DH-Abu to the tetrapeptide L-Val-D-Ser-L-Lys-Sar. The carboxy group of Sar is esterified with the hydroxy group of D-aThr. The N-terminus is formed by D-cysteic acid, which is N-acylated by β-ketoacyl residues and is connected to the cyclic octapeptide lactone via the amino group of D-a Thr.

    Description / Table of Contents: Antibiotics from Gliding Bacteria, XXII. - The Biosynthesis of Myxopyronin A, an Antibiotic from Myxococcus fulvus, Strain Mx f50The biosynthesis of the antibiotic myxopyronin A (1) from acetate, glycine, and methionine was investigated by feeding experiments with the corresponding 13C- and 15N labeled precursors and observing the labeling pattern by 13C-NMR. The carbon skeleton of the antibiotic is derived from two polyacetate chains. Glycine is incorporated as starting unit into one of the chains. Two of the three methyl groups are incorporated from methionine, the third one from C-2 of acetate.

    Description / Table of Contents: Multistep Reversible Redox Systems, XXXIX.  -  Isomeric Biazulenyls: UV/VIS Spectroscopy, Voltammetry, and HMO EnergiesUV/VIS spectra and voltammetrically determined redox properties of isomeric biazulenyls depend strongly on the positions of linkage between the azulenyl groups. All isomers can be reversibly reduced in two steps (KSEMc = 2·103 to 6·1010), however, only the 1,1′-isomer (4.0) can be reversibly oxidized (in two steps; KSEMa = 1.4·106). Comparison of redox potentials and HOMO/LUMO energies allows estimation of steric effects caused by different degrees of twisting of the isomers. Besides, in some cases the possibility of triplet states can be derived.

    Notes: Cyanothyl-subsituted cylohexyl cyclohexanoates, bi(cyclohexanes) and phenyl cyclohexanes were synthisized. Their mesmorphic behaviour is compared to that of the corresponding cyano derivatives. (Cyanoethyl)cyclohexyl cyclohenxanoates show mesmorphic properties in contrast to the corresponding cyano derivative. Separation of the cyano substituent from the rigid core of an anisotropic aliphatic compound by methylene groups enhances the thermodynamic stability of the mesophase. In aromatic compound, the cyanoethyl group leads to lower clearing points. These phenomena are attributed to teh influence of steric effects on the packing density and to the dependence of the clearing point on molecular association.

    Notes: The conformational behaviour of metoclopramide, a neuroleptic benzamide, and model compounds was investigated byt 1 H-NMR spectroscopy. An intramolecular amide-methoxy H-bond is shown to exist in CDCl3-solution, but not in D2O-solution, independently of the length and protonation state of the basic side-chain. This H-bond creates a virtual cycle which may be a key feature for the binding of neuroleptic benzamides to the dopamine receptor. The conformational behaviour of the aminoethyl side-chain is shown to be markedly condition-dependent. For metoclopramide and its analogues in their protonated form, the gauche- and trans- rotamers have identical energies in D2O-as well as in CDCl3-solutins. For the non-protonated molecules, the trans-rotamer is favoured in D2O-solutin, while the gauche-rotamer is favoured in CDCl3-solution (ΔG°≃|0.5|kcal/mol in both cases). The side-chain conformation of neuroleptic benzamides is discussed in terms of receptor affinity.

    Notes: The determination of the dimerisation constant (KD) for the weak self-association of a compound C in dilute solution according to the equilibrium, 2C⇌C2 is described. The method uses chemical shifts measured on a series of solutions of C at different concentrations: the optimum KD is defined by a linear regression best-fit procedure, which simultaneously determines optimum values for δo and also for δ∞, the intrinsic chemical shifts for nuclei in the monomer and dimer species. The dimerisation of caffeine in D2O is used as a model to demonstrate the working of the method and the quality of results obtained. The most probable value of KD for caffeine at 30.5° is found in the range 5.5-6.0 kg solution · mol-1, and the enthalpy and entropy of dimerisation are found to be ΔH⊖ = -15.1 kJ · mol-1 and ΔS⊖ = -35.3 J · °C-1 · mol-1, respectively. The influence of small errors in δo on the confidence limits of KD is discussed.
